Abnormal Skin Color Changes

Human skin color naturally varies across a beautiful spectrum, but sometimes unexpected changes catch our attention. Abnormal skin color changes, medically known as dyschromia, represent alterations in normal skin pigmentation that can appear as patches, spots, or widespread areas of discoloration. These changes range from harmless age spots to signals of underlying health conditions.

Causes & Risk Factors

Several factors can contribute to Abnormal Skin Color Changes.

Skin color changes stem from problems with melanin production, distribution, or breakdown.

Sun exposure ranks as the leading cause, triggering melanocytes to produce excess pigment in an attempt to protect deeper skin layers from UV damage. This process creates age spots, melasma, and post-inflammatory hyperpigmentation. Hormonal fluctuations, particularly during pregnancy or while taking birth control pills, can also stimulate melanin production in specific patterns.

Medical conditions frequently disrupt normal pigmentation.

Medical conditions frequently disrupt normal pigmentation. Autoimmune diseases like vitiligo destroy melanocytes, leaving white patches where pigment cells once existed. Endocrine disorders such as Addison's disease or thyroid problems can darken or lighten skin tone. Certain medications, including antimalarials, chemotherapy drugs, and some antibiotics, may cause temporary or permanent color changes as side effects.

Genetic factors play a significant role in many pigmentation disorders. Some people inherit tendencies toward melasma, café-au-lait spots, or other specific types of discoloration. Nutritional deficiencies, particularly of vitamins B12, folate, or iron, can alter skin color. Additionally, exposure to certain chemicals, metals, or toxins may cause characteristic color changes that help doctors identify specific poisoning or occupational exposures.

Diagnosis

How healthcare professionals diagnose Abnormal Skin Color Changes:

  • 1

    Diagnosing abnormal skin color changes typically begins with a thorough visual examination and medical history.

Dermatologists examine the affected areas under normal and specialized lighting to assess the extent, pattern, and characteristics of discoloration. They ask about when changes first appeared, whether they've spread or darkened, and any associated symptoms like itching or pain. Family history, medication use, and recent life changes provide additional diagnostic clues.

    Several diagnostic tools help confirm suspected conditions. Wood's lamp examination uses ultraviolet light to highlight certain types of pigmentation that aren't visible under normal lighting. Dermoscopy magnifies skin structures to reveal detailed patterns that distinguish between different causes of discoloration. Digital photography often documents changes over time, helping track treatment progress or disease progression.

    When skin examination alone doesn't provide clear answers, doctors may order additional tests. Blood work can identify nutritional deficiencies, hormonal imbalances, or autoimmune conditions. In some cases, skin biopsy removes a small tissue sample for microscopic examination. This procedure proves particularly useful when doctors suspect skin cancer, unusual infections, or rare genetic conditions. Patch testing may be performed if contact allergies are suspected as the cause of color changes.

Prevention

  • Sun protection forms the foundation of preventing most acquired skin color changes.
  • Daily sunscreen application with at least SPF 30 blocks harmful UV rays that trigger excess melanin production.
  • Reapplying sunscreen every two hours during outdoor activities ensures continued protection.
  • Seeking shade during peak sun hours (10 AM to 4 PM) and wearing protective clothing, wide-brimmed hats, and UV-blocking sunglasses provide additional defense against skin damage.
  • Gentle skincare practices help prevent post-inflammatory hyperpigmentation following acne, cuts, or other skin irritation.
  • Avoiding picking at blemishes, treating acne promptly, and using fragrance-free products reduce inflammation that can trigger pigment changes.
  • When injuries do occur, proper wound care and keeping affected areas protected from sun exposure minimize the risk of permanent discoloration.
  • For people with genetic predispositions to certain pigmentation disorders, early intervention and careful monitoring prove most effective.
  • Regular dermatology checkups allow for prompt treatment of emerging issues.
  • Maintaining good overall health through balanced nutrition, adequate sleep, and stress management supports healthy skin function.
  • While some color changes can't be entirely prevented, these measures significantly reduce their likelihood and severity.

Treatment for abnormal skin color changes varies dramatically depending on the underlying cause and patient preferences.

For sun-induced hyperpigmentation, topical treatments often provide the first line of defense. Hydroquinone, tretinoin, and kojic acid work by inhibiting melanin production or promoting cell turnover to fade dark spots. Newer formulations combine multiple active ingredients for enhanced effectiveness while reducing irritation risks.

Professional procedures offer faster, more dramatic results for stubborn discoloration. Chemical peels remove damaged surface layers, revealing fresher skin underneath. Laser therapy targets specific pigments without damaging surrounding tissue, making it ideal for age spots, melasma, and certain birthmarks. Intense pulsed light (IPL) treats larger areas of sun damage effectively. Microneedling with radiofrequency stimulates collagen production while improving overall skin tone and texture.

For conditions like vitiligo, treatment focuses on stopping progression and restoring lost pigment where possible.

Topical corticosteroids and calcineurin inhibitors suppress the autoimmune response destroying melanocytes. Phototherapy using narrow-band UV light can stimulate repigmentation, particularly on the face and neck. Newer treatments like JAK inhibitors show promise for halting vitiligo progression and promoting color restoration.

Systemic treatments address underlying medical causes of skin color changes. Hormone therapy may help melasma triggered by pregnancy or birth control pills. Nutritional supplements correct deficiencies causing abnormal pigmentation. For medication-induced color changes, switching to alternative treatments often allows gradual improvement. Cosmetic camouflage techniques and high-quality makeup provide immediate coverage while other treatments take effect, helping people feel confident during the healing process.

Frequently Asked Questions

How long do treatments for skin discoloration typically take to show results?
Most topical treatments require 6-12 weeks of consistent use before noticeable improvement appears. Professional procedures like chemical peels or laser therapy may show initial results within 2-4 weeks, with continued improvement over several months.
Can skin color changes be a sign of serious health problems?
While most skin discoloration is benign, sudden widespread changes, new irregular spots, or color changes accompanied by other symptoms should be evaluated by a doctor. Some conditions like Addison's disease or skin cancer can cause characteristic pigmentation changes.
Will my insurance cover treatment for abnormal skin color changes?
Insurance typically covers treatment when discoloration results from underlying medical conditions but may not cover cosmetic treatments. Check with your insurance provider about specific procedures and consider discussing medical necessity with your dermatologist.
Are there natural remedies that effectively treat skin discoloration?
Some natural ingredients like vitamin C, licorice extract, and kojic acid can help with mild discoloration. However, prescription treatments and professional procedures generally provide faster, more dramatic results for significant color changes.
Can diet changes help improve skin pigmentation problems?
A healthy diet rich in antioxidants supports overall skin health, and correcting nutritional deficiencies can improve some types of discoloration. However, diet alone rarely resolves significant pigmentation issues that require targeted treatments.
Is it safe to use multiple treatments for skin discoloration at the same time?
Combining treatments can be effective but should only be done under dermatologist guidance. Some combinations may cause irritation or interfere with each other's effectiveness.
Will sun exposure make my skin discoloration worse?
Yes, UV exposure typically darkens existing pigmentation and can trigger new spots to form. Consistent sun protection is essential for preventing worsening and maintaining treatment results.
Can skin color changes return after successful treatment?
Some types of discoloration may recur, especially melasma and sun spots, particularly with hormonal changes or sun exposure. Maintenance treatments and sun protection help prevent recurrence.
Are certain skin types more prone to pigmentation problems?
People with darker skin tones are more susceptible to post-inflammatory hyperpigmentation, while fair-skinned individuals are more prone to sun damage and age spots. However, pigmentation issues can affect all skin types.
Should I avoid certain skincare ingredients if I have skin discoloration?
Harsh scrubs, strong fragrances, and certain acids can worsen inflammation and pigmentation. Your dermatologist can recommend gentle, effective products appropriate for your specific condition and skin type.
